The location of the hotel is very good, between Shinsaibashi Station and Nagahoribashi Station, and you can get there just up the street from the subway underground. It only takes less than two minutes to walk from the hotel to Shinsaibashi shopping street. At the same time, there are many izakayas, bars or restaurants within 500 meters of the hotel. As stated on the website, the counter staff can speak Chinese/Korean/English. It’s not like other hotels where the counter still doesn’t understand your question after explaining it for a long time. The accommodation, whether it was the bed or the bathroom, made me feel very high-end, beyond my imagination. Furthermore, the hotel also provides delicious free coffee on the second floor. Finally, this hotel also provides luggage storage to the airport. Although the service costs money, it is very convenient for those of us with very heavy luggage. We don’t have to carry our luggage and run around.

4 night stay
Upside:
(1) Staff quality - Staff paid attention to details and showed thoughtful concern about guests. E.g. when I indicated while making the reservation that I would be arriving late at night, they emailed me with instructions of how to enter the hotel after midnight. They also offered advice on how best to get from Kansai airport to the hotel. Then, when I arrived even later than expected due to my flight being delayed, they emailed to check on me.
(2) Location - Right in the heart of the action in Shinsaibashi, with many shops, restaurants and services nearby. Nearest Osaka Metro station is about a 5 minute walk away.
(3) Good soundproofing - Despite the neighborhood being busy at all hours, there was hardly any sound coming into the room. E.g. I'd no issue taking naps during the day due to jet-lag.
(4) Clean, fresh and modern room, with efficient use of space in both room and bathroom.
Downside:
(1) Limited views - Perhaps for privacy and security reasons, the sliding door leading to the external corridor is frosted and is blocked from opening completely. However, this means that while light can come in, my room didn't really have any view despite being on the 7th floor.
(2) No on-site gym - Although the hotel has an arrangement with a Gold's Gym, it's about a 10-minute walk away. Walking to/from the gym wasn't an issue at this time of the year, as the weather was warm enough that I could walk outside in gym clothes. But, in winter, you may need to pack clothes and toiletries to change and shower at the gym. Also, foreigners might be unfamiliar with certain gym norms in Japan - e.g. you're required to wear gym shoes that have not been worn outdoors (limited number available for rent at an additional fee); tattoos must not be visible; etc. A tip - to avoid having to bring along your passport to show to the gym's reception, take a photo of it on your phone.

It's a nice boutique hotel, efficient service, with awesome free coffee on its lobby floor. On-site laundry service makes it convenient for those that needs to have clean clothes after a lengthy travel. We book 2 standard twin rooms. The rooms are a bit small. I know that this is probably standard in Japan but there is just no place for your luggage to stay open. If 2 of you wanted to open both your luggage's to get stuff, then it is just very tight space. Location is good but not great. Near the Shinsaibashi station but not that close. My room's temperature was not really acting well. If I set is on heater mode even at 20C the room gets too hot. If I set to an aircon mode it goes quite cool so not sure how their thermostat works. However, our other room was fine. Rooms are clean, no coffee in room, only green tea. Showers are good, towels not fluffy but just standard and clean. Instagrammable front facade. Good room keys for security entering the building late at night and accessing the elevators. Get some restaurant tips from the front desk, some are good some are not as accurate on their opening times so better check directly with the restaurant's official site.

Stayed at Hotel The Flag Shinsaibashi. It is a small tiny hotel along a alley close to the busy shopping street, where we can find Diamaru and Parco department store. A short walk to Shinsaibashi subway (Midosuji Line), a few exits for access to subway. Guests are able to help themselves to ice and cool drinking water, plus coffee and tea at any time of the day. In my opinion, this is wonderful during this hot period. The Breakfast spread is good enough for us before the start of a day, we truly enjoyed it. Generally, the hotel rooms in Japan is pretty small in size, so we are prepared mentally. Though the room is small with not much moving space, the bed seem to be a supper single (I guess) and very comfortable too. Room assigned to us may be a bit closer to the night club, where we could hear faint tempo sound in the night, but it was not an big issue to us during our stay as we were so tired after a long day out. Counter Staff and café staff are very helpful and able to communicate in English. Notes were left for us of updates on our requests. Though it is not a hotel with many facilities but it is Good for us and we did enjoyed our stay at The Flag.
